1. 程式人生 > >使用Dreamweaver CS5進行PHP實時開…

使用Dreamweaver CS5進行PHP實時開…

   大家知道PHP程式碼需要在伺服器端執行,我們開發時不能所見即所得。其實Dreamweaver具備這個功能的。 配置也挺簡單,下面介紹配置和示例。 1.新建一個PHP檔案,點選儲存設定好本地存檔目錄。 2.點選站點選單,新建一個站點,這裡配置比較關鍵,如下圖: 使用Dreamweaver <wbr>CS5進行PHP實時開發及陣列迴圈示例
如上圖,設定好ftp伺服器IP,使用者名稱,密碼,和根目錄,注意根目錄設定,我的是linux伺服器,設定網站目錄 比如我的放在/home/wwwroot/phpstudy/ 目錄下 webURL也很關鍵,否者不能正常呼叫顯示,如果你存檔的檔名是index.php ,而網站那預設的檔案就是index.php那麼可以省略index.php,如果不是index.php,那麼需要跟上具體的檔名,比如: http://www.hao9go.com/phpstudy/test.php 點選測試,測試通過後就可以編寫程式碼了,下面是3中方法迴圈顯示陣列的程式碼: <!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d"> <html xmlns="http://www.w3.org/1999/xhtml"> <head> <meta http-equiv="Content-Type" content="text/html; charset=utf-8" /> <title>PHP練習</title> </head> <body> <?php $price=array('apple'=>5,'branana'=>4,'orange'=>3); echo "使用迴圈顯示陣列值練習<br />"; echo "下面是第一種方法測試 <br />"; while ($element = each($price)) { echo $element['key']; echo "-"; echo $element['value']; echo "<br />"; } reset($price); echo "下面是第二種方法測試<br />"; while(list($product,$pr)=each($price)) { echo "$product - $pr <br />"; } echo "下面是第三種方法測試<br />"; foreach($price as $key => $value) { echo $key."-".$value."<br />"; } ?> 編寫完成後,點選一下實時試圖,就會提示上傳檔案到伺服器,點選是,完成後,拆分視窗的右邊試圖就顯示,PHP檔案執行的結果。

使用Dreamweaver <wbr>CS5進行PHP實時開發及陣列迴圈示例


如果有問題檢查一下,下圖的幾個選項設定對沒有,還有伺服器目錄有沒有讀寫許可權等 使用Dreamweaver <wbr>CS5進行PHP實時開發及陣列迴圈示例